The Mridangam classroom must be a charged space, but sometimes with the fast moving world, it gets more cerebral than experiential. This series is an effort to dial back the teaching methodology in Mridangam playing to one that organically transfers nuances in playing without verbally communicating. In gratitude to my gurus Guruvayur Sri Dorai, Uuzhavoor Sri PK Babu and Nellai Sri A Balaji for passing on so generously this wonderful art form to me and enabling me to share it with a few friends in turn. This video explores the majestic composition of Mridangam maestro Palani Sri Subramaniam Pillai and I'm joined in this session by my student Aryan Ramesh.
